Dell - Consultant - Global Ethics & Compliance (10-14 yrs)

Bangalore Job Code: 771688

Description:

- You will primarily investigate a wide array of serious allegations of wrongdoing by Dell India employees. Not only will you be responsible for obtaining the necessary evidence to substantiate the allegations, but you will also be required to present the evidence in a manner which can be easily understood by internal stakeholders.


- This role also leads and executes other ethics initiatives such as messaging, communication and training. The Role reports to the VP Legal & Ethics.The Role requires strong working relationships with leaders in the business and functions (Legal & Compliance, Finance, HR and others). The Role also requires extensive collaboration and coordination with other members of the global Ethics & Compliance team.

Major Responsibilities:

- Investigate a variety of matters such as white collar crime, harassment and discrimination and compliance issues such as trade compliance, corruption, financial reporting, etc. across a range of processes and businesses.

- Lead, oversee and execute investigations either individually or in conjunction with other teams and ensure that appropriate investigative steps and protocols are followed.

- Work closely and collaborate with HR, Legal, Security Team members in ensuring timely and effective closure of investigations.

- Work closely with technical investigators who have the requisite skills to obtain digital evidence

- Evaluate the nuances of issues and recommend disciplinary and corrective action to appropriate decision makers.

- Implement and evangelise proactive initiates such as communications, messaging and training on topics relating to ethics and compliance.

- Collaborate and participate in Compliance Committees with senior management teams to drive understanding and accountability of compliance risks.

- Be a Trusted Business Partner: deliver effective compliance counsel and advice to leaders and employees across the Market. Act as the primary contact point and internal expert with respect to ethics & compliance matters

- Build strong, effective relationships with key business, functional and E&C leaders and employees to drive awareness and accountability for compliance issues programs.

- Conduct and/or cascade targeted training on compliance-related topics, latest policies and/or procedures.

- Drive a culture of integrity, compliance and accountability from the top leaders in the organization through to all employees.

Competencies:

- Strong written and verbal communication skills: clear communicator who can write and speak simply and effectively

- Able to operate effectively in complex organisational and matrixed environments

- Demonstrated ability to partner effectively with others in addressing complex issues

- Able to work independently, including ability to identify, plan and execute own priorities

- Adept at solving complex, business critical problems in a calm manner and with sound business judgment.

- Strong networker, internally and externally.

- Able to work well with ambiguity

- A team player with a strong ethos of collegiality and mutual respect.
